I am struggling to find an easy way to run a report - in DCE &/or DCO that can do the following for me;
- total power in current (amps) for cabinets - Row A - to Row I,
- total current for individual cabinet
- total current per feed (Single phase A feed and B feed, Three phase A feed and B feed)
Currently, I am simply extracting all the current for each PDU, for each row and for each power feed. This is extremely exhausting. Is there a simpler way of creating this report?

If you're saying that you have for example 10 amps per rack and you want to see A-I added together, you'll want to use virtual sensors in DCE. A virtual sensor can sum or average numerous values.
If you have multiple PDUs or other values per rack, you can create rack total sensors, row total sensors, room total sensors, etc. Setting this up may be time consuming but you have to only do this once and running future reports is as simple as running the reports on the virtual sensors.
